【摘要】 稻田昆虫群落是农业昆虫群落总体的重要组成部分,也是稻田生态系统的重要结构。本文综述了我国稻田昆虫群落多样性及生态调控功能研究进展。显示,我国的稻田昆虫群落研究,主要围绕天敌资源利用与水稻害虫防治两个方面,且基于水稻害虫防治中心目标开展。而且,稻田昆虫群落常被分为捕食性昆虫、寄生性昆虫、中性昆虫、水稻害虫等亚群落或功能团被研究,且昆虫群落中重要天敌昆虫种群与重要水稻害虫种群密切联系。为此,本文主要就我国稻田昆虫群落与组成、稻田昆虫多样性与资源、水稻害虫发生动态、防治方法策略与害虫生态调控、食物网营养关系与能流、采样技术方法、稻田生态安全性评价指示生物等进展进行了介绍,并指出了未来发展的方向。

【Abstract】 Paddy field insect communities are an important part of the agricultural, and paddy field, ecosystem. The study of insect communities in paddy fields in China is mainly focused on controlling rice pests, particularly by utilizing their natural enemies in paddy fields. Insect communities in paddy fields are often divided into four sub-communities, or functional groups;predatory insects, parasitic insects, neutral insects and rice pests. The abundance of natural enemies is closely related to the abundance of rice pests. Main research topics include the composition, diversity and resources of insect communities, population dynamics of rice pests, control strategies and the ecological control of rice pests, nutritional relationships and energy flow within the food web, sampling techniques, and biological indicators of ecological health and food safety in paddy fields.
